The Opportunity

As Principal Contract and Commercial Manager, you'll lead a high-performing team, shaping commercial strategy and supplier partnerships that drive our renewable growth. You'll be the focal point for supplier accountability, governance and dispute resolution across our onshore and offshore assets.

You'll bring deep knowledge of contract law and commercial negotiation. You'll support new revenue streams and optimise value from existing agreements, while contributing to bid management, insurance processes and financial oversight.

This role is based from our Durham office on a hybrid basis, with occasional travel to our onshore wind farms and other UK offices. You'll also have opportunities to travel to countries within Europe, including team meetings in France.

Who You Are

We're looking for a Principal Contract and Commercial Manager who is commercially astute, confident in governance, and experienced in leading supplier negotiations. To be shortlisted, you need to offer

  • Experience in commercial contracting and contract law, ideally within the energy or industrial sector
  • Proven ability to draft, negotiate and manage complex contracts and frameworks
  • Experience managing governance processes and resolving commercial disputes
  • Ability to travel across the UK and Europe, including to wind farm sites and supplier meetings
  • Experience managing insurance processes and contributing to bid management
  • Strong financial awareness including budgeting and reporting
  • Experience leading teams and developing commercial strategies

What You'll Be Doing

  • Leading the Commercial team to manage supplier relationships and contract performance
  • Overseeing governance, compliance and dispute resolution across key agreements
  • Leading the developing of commercial systems and processes to ensure continuous improvement.
  • Leading Commercial bid management and supporting insurance processes for operational assets
  • Driving the commercial strategy across onshore, offshore and SSPW assets
  • Collaborating with internal teams and international suppliers to optimise value

Why EDF Power Solutions?

At EDF power solutions UK & Ireland we're committed to tackling climate change. Our rapidly growing team of 600 talented people share an ambition to create a net zero future where clean, green, energy powers all our lives.

It's a huge ambition and time is of the essence if we are to play our full part in meeting the UK and Ireland's challenging net zero targets. With our unique mix of technologies including onshore and offshore wind, solar PV, battery storage and green hydrogen we are the UK & Ireland's most diverse generator of renewable energy.

To achieve our goal of generating a massive 10GW of renewable energy by 2035, we're working with stakeholders and communities throughout the UK and Ireland to unlock the enormous potential of the low carbon energy sector.
